We are partnering with a leading organisation in the Eye Care market, to recruit an impactful Sustainability Lead who will shape and drive the company’s environmental strategy. In this role, you’ll work closely with senior leaders, external partners and cross-functional teams to deliver meaningful change, influence culture and bring new ideas to life.

This is a full-time permanent position, working remotely with limited travel to our client’s office when required.

What’s on offer?

* Excellent Salary & Benefits – Up to £60,000 basic (dependent upon experience) plus benefits

* Collaborative Culture - Thrive in a supportive, people-focused environment.

* Entrepreneurial Spirit - Enjoy the agility and visibility of an ambitious organisation where you can make a real difference.

* Job Stability – Thrive in one of the industry’s most resilient and future-proof organisations

Ideal Requirements

* A strong background in sustainability is required.

* At least 3 years’ successful track record in project management.

* Proven experience in sustainability management, environmental compliance, or related fields.

* Healthcare or Pharmaceutical background is preferred, but not essential.

Role Responsibilities

* Lead and deliver the sustainability strategy, ensuring compliance, tracking performance, and driving continuous improvement across the organisation.

* Use data and audits to drive action, analysing sustainability performance, strengthening product and packaging compliance, and producing clear, insight-led reports.

* Promote innovation, researching new technologies, identifying carbon-reduction opportunities, and embedding a culture of sustainable practice.

* Engage and influence stakeholders, collaborating with internal teams and external partners, delivering training, and producing the annual Impact Report.
